‘I would enjoy the US’ – Messi intrigued by MLS

Although the Argentina international is focusing on Barcelona at the moment, his departure at the end of the Campaign is probable.

The Argentine star

Lionel Messi

admitted his desire in joining Major League Soccer. However, the

Barcelona

legend insists that no transfer discussions will take place until the summer as he is focused on this season.

The 33-year-old’s contract is due to expire by the end of the season and he is being linked with a move from Barcelona.

Among the possible destinations of the Barcelona legend are

Manchester City

and

Paris Saint-Germain

, but Messi is considering all his options.

Messi has revealed his interest in a profitable move to MLS, following after David Beckham, Thierry Henry, and others.

"

I

<em>

always said that I have the impression that I would like to enjoy the experience of living in the United States, of living in that league and that life, but if it happens or not I don't know,

" the Argentine said.

When asked about a possible move to Atletico Madrid or Real Madrid, he responded: "

No, impossible

." 

The Argentine has made a promise to put transfer discussions off until the summer, concentrating on performing his best for Barcelona.

"

I have nothing clear until the end of the year, I will wait for the end of the season," he said. "The important thing is to think about the team, finish the year, think about trying to get titles and not be distracted by other things. 

"I don't know what's going to happen, I'm focused on what we have, on what can be done in these six months. I don't think about how the year will end because today it wouldn't be good for me to tell you what am I going to do because I don't know. 

"I don't know if I'm going to leave or not and if I leave, I would like to leave in the best way.

"Always speaking hypothetically, I would like to return some day. I would like to return to the city, to work at the club, to contribute. Barcelona is much bigger than any player, even me obviously, and I hope that the president who comes in will do things well to help us lift important titles again

." 

Despite his interest in the US, Manchester City still stands a chance is linking with Messi as he keeps in touch with his ex-mentor Pep Guardiola.
